Codiaeum variegatum (
garden croton or
variegated croton; syn.
Croton variegatum L.) is a species of plant in the genus
Codiaeum, which is a member of the family Euphorbiaceae. It is native to Indonesia, Malaysia, Australia, and the western Pacific Ocean islands, growing in open forests and scrub.
